TCM should play this movie cause i can't find it anywhere.
After years of neglect, half-brothers Stefane and Antony (James Fox, John Alderton) decide to steal their unloving father's hefty fortune. But first, they enlist the help of cunning ex-crook Duffy (James Coburn), who is intrigued by the cash, and even more so, by Stefane's lovely girlfriend, also in on the heist. While the plan runs smoothly, a strange mix-up in the aftermath leads Duffy to question the motives of his new accomplices. Susannah York, James Mason also star in this comedy. 101 min. Widescreen; Soundtrack: English Dolby Digital mono.
Category: Comedy Director: Robert Parrish
Cast: John Alderton, James Coburn, Guy Deghy, Peter van Dissel, Carl Duering, James Fox, Tutte Lemkow, Marne Maitland, James Mason, Steve Plytas, Susannah York

i wouldn't mind if tcm showed Criss Cross (1949). starring Burt Lancaster and Yvonne DeCarlo. never seen it. here's the plot summary:
Romantic, obsessive Steve Thompson is drawn back to L.A. to make another try for Anna, his former wife. However, Anna belongs now to the L.A. underworld. Steve believes he can rescue her, ignoring the advice and warnings of people who would try to save him. He commits himself to a dangerous course of action that quickly takes everyone somewhere unintended.
